https://www.pjrc.com). Originally deemed the DuotrigesimalWS2811, the Teensy Pixel Pusher was designed for the Teensy4.1, this board has 32 outputs for the led strands and an Ethernet connection that accesses the built in Ethernet on the Teensy 4.1 chip.
I designed and built this board to take advantage of the computing power of the teensy 4.1 as well as the on board Ethernet for E1.31 pixel control. The mounting holes are designed to fit cable guard enclosures. Example code to run the board is available from [GitHub](

This is an improvement on the octoWS2811 in the number of outputs available, and the availability of the onboard ethernet. This is the board only, and does not include the Teensy 4.1, that can be purchased elsewhere.
The Version 3.1 improves upon previous versions by allowing a direct 5v connection to power the Teensy, as well as providing pinouts for 3.3v, 5v, Ground, and Pins 0, 1, 2, 3, 4, 29, 33, 40, and 41. The silkscreen has also been improved. All other functionality of the original Teensy Pixel Pusher remains in tact.

The splitter and power injector board is designed to interface with this board.
This board is designed to accept the 4-port Adam Tech MTJF-4-88GX1-FSB RJ45 sockets for the data out. The ethernet adapter is a WIZnet J1B1211CCD RJ45 jack with magnetics.
